API Integrations Explained 

Since “API” itself stands for “Application Programming Interface,” you should understand what the acronym means. For starters, an “interface” is present in all forms of technology. A light switch holds an extremely straightforward interface, while a microwave requires a little bit more effort to communicate and achieve a specific task. The interfaces of the devices are extremely intuitive; they make it far easier to use each device without needing to comprehend the exact science behind each of them. There is no need to know why or how the microwave can heat things up since the interface communicates your wants for you, without needing any advanced sciences.

Consider the mechanisms beneath the hood of a car: they are extremely complicated, right? Without being a specialist, you might not know which component controls what, why it controls it, or how it even works. On the inside of the car, however, you have a limited amount of very intuitive controls you may complete to get the car to function. You may have no idea why pressing the gas pedal causes the car to roll forward, but you know how to stop quickly, change directions, and shift gears. That’s because the car’s interface is simple compared to its internal setup.

“Application Programming,” or the AP section of API, refers to how the applications communicate with each other. For example, a Knoxville web design expert may reference “hitting an API” when discussing web services that allow them to send requests and, in return, receive data. Web APIs follow the same premise. Browsers (such as Google Chrome, Safari, and Internet Explorer) have web APIs built into them to help with adding features to sites.

Getting Started: Building an API

Here’s all you need to know about getting started with API development.

1. Identify your goals and intended users.

Determine the goal you are wanting to accomplish and the target users you have in mind. This will be the backbone for the rest of the process.

2. Design the architecture you’ll need for the API.

Your API will need to meet 5 “requirements” for best results:

  • Usability: developers should be able to learn/use your API without much of a struggle
  • Reliability: should have minimal downtime involved
  • Scalability: should be able to handle load spikes
  • Testability: defects should be easily identifiable
  • Security: should have some sort of protection from malware or malicious users

Separate your API into 3 layers: 

  • Validation layer: controls access to all interactions with the app
  • Caching layer: sends the client caching instructions
  • Orchestration layer: combines the data from different sources

Remember: keep it small. Use either the REST or SOAP architectural style. Currently, REST is the most popular, but use what works best for you.

3. Develop the API.

Time to get into it. Here’s a basic list of what to do:

  • Define API responses
  • Handle exceptions and errors
  • Build an API endpoint (REST example here)
  • Implement pagination and search by criteria
  • Analyze the API for performance
  • Begin client-side caching
  • Write API documentation
  • For public API, add versioning
  • Use throttling

4. Test the API.  

Test your API using realistic data, a variety of network conditions, and realistic simulations. Make necessary notes.

5. Monitor the API, record feedback, and implement changes.

Use your notes to implement changes and improve your API.
